Output dd3e3b7190d9c71ff54985e7b3d096fb0b54bb9a3ca9ad2ada95916501c42262:2

value
13500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d08d545a531c65e647bf42c0d0c00674db830e3 OP_EQUAL
address
38iLY3nVhQGicyMYrEbN1aKJtSHYrqXxLt
transaction
dd3e3b7190d9c71ff54985e7b3d096fb0b54bb9a3ca9ad2ada95916501c42262
confirmations
187900
spent
true